Determine the kinetic energy of body of mass \( 4kg \) moving at \( 6m/s \).

  • A 72 J energy
  • B 96 J energy
  • C 48 J energy
  • D 36 J energy
Correct Answer: Option A
Explanation:
Kinetic energy: \( KE = \dfrac12 mv^2 \) \( KE = \dfrac12 \times 4 \times 6^2 \) \( KE = 2 \times 36 \) \( KE = 72J \) Therefore, the kinetic energy is \( 72J \).
